Emily Bleeker
A funny, bittersweet novel about a mother-daughter stand-up comedy rivalry that becomes the only honest conversation they’ve ever had, from the author of When We Were Enemies.
When struggling Chicago stand-up comic Chloe Masterson turns a disastrous family dinner into a viral comedy set, her mother becomes the punch line—winning Chloe new fans, new gigs, and the big break she’s spent years chasing.
But Mary isn’t laughing.
After discovering her daughter has turned their private history into comedy gold, she grabs the mic to give Chloe a taste of her own medicine. But what begins as a mother’s attempt to prove a point turns into a genuine shot at the spotlight. Mary is good at stand-up—really good.
As she secretly rises through Chicago’s comedy ranks, Chloe is doing the same on the other side of the city, completely unaware her mother is becoming something far more dangerous than inspiration—competition. Soon, both women are barreling toward the same career-defining opportunity and a very public head-on collision.
As their rivalry heats up and old wounds resurface, Chloe and Mary must decide what matters more: winning the spotlight or finding their way back to each other.
